美文网首页
Golang递归遍历目录

Golang递归遍历目录

作者: 懒人程序猿 | 来源:发表于2020-04-17 15:17 被阅读0次

递归遍历目录下文件及文件及

func WalkDir(filePath string) {
    files, err := ioutil.ReadDir(filePath)
    if err != nil {
        fmt.Println(err.Error())
    } else {
        for _, v := range files {
            if v.IsDir() {
                WalkDir(v.Name())
            } else {
                fmt.Println(v.Name())
            }
        }
    }
}

相关文章

网友评论

      本文标题:Golang递归遍历目录

      本文链接:https://www.haomeiwen.com/subject/kbhyvhtx.html